The Power Of Cognitive Substance Abuse Treatment!


A scientific approach in substance abuse treatment has emerged as the cognitive substance abuse treatment that analyzes the thought patterns of a patient's brain and actual causes that stimulates him or her to like drugs. Drug users are always seeking out new highs and the kind of kick that can be achieved when they inject themselves with the substance of their choice. Drawing on past and present records of medical studies, doctors work to understand the brain's common responses when it is subjected though a series of altered states so the doctors can possibly pinpoint areas of concern and create counter measures that powerfully works to solve the root causes of drug craving.

While undergoing the cognitive substance abuse treatment, the doctors involved must be resolute in making notes on how the patient responds to the treatment. The emotional and physical state of the substance abuser must be recorded just moments before they partake in the toxic substance. The drug abuser's post drug taking bodily states are also to be recorded for references in the research as well.

Some people are born with a higher tendency to become drug abusers. It's not because they are bad but it is due to their body. Some people who have a frontal cortex that is kind of abnormal in a small way may experience more difficulties trying to say no to illegal substances. This is the time the physician will tabulate all findings and do their best to create a solution which is effective for the patient.

Moments before taking drugs, the drug abuser's frontal cortex will be very active. The frontal cortex's activity is being surpressed so feelings of desire for drugs are destroyed before they surface. This is the kind results which the drug abuse treatment industry needs. It is then apparent that the cognitive substance abuse treatment is successful as craving has been eliminated.

There is not one physician out there who will tell you substance abuse treatment is easy because it isn't. Many parts of our brains are complex and complicated and researchers may miss out the vital areas related to drug abuse craving. Medical doctors have discovered that it is helpful to segregate patients of different substances to different groups. Therefore, substance abusers will be studied on how they react to the said substance and what influenced their feelings in the period of addiction. This is to help doctors understand further. Obviously, there are still many stones left unturned in these studies because of one thing, the brain works as a whole unit and it is difficult to isolate which part is solely reactive to drug cravings. The power of influence exerted by the brain and how drugs affect the actions and emotions of a user is quite a mystery by itself.

Conquering drug abuse could be very difficult with little results because of certain complications, and being too involved in cognitive research can cause researchers big opportunity costs in terms of other studies. Unintentionally, many new non cognitive methods of substance abuse treatment are missed out. Another wise thing to do would be to research about our blood system and liver system which could even reduce withdrawal symptoms and put and end to relapses.

Doctors sometimes use emotional fear in cognitive substance abuse. Scientists hypothesized that fear cancels out the pleasure derived from drug abuse and it is good because that can prevent drug abuse cases totally before it happens. This can be especially workable on those that have not tried or done drugs before as they do not have a mental reference on the euphoric feelings associated with drug abuse. So, these people will feel disgusted and even uncomfortable when they are presented with the opportunity to abuse drugs.
